Product overview.
RentedRide.com is an asset-light marketplace that aggregates local rental operators rather than owning vehicles. It is Goa-first, India-focused and designed to expand into other tourism-driven markets.
The responsive, mobile-first web application covers cars, self-drive cars, scooters and motorbikes. A native mobile application is not required for initial market validation.
The problem.
Discovery is fragmented across WhatsApp, search, social media, hotels and roadside shops. Customers face unclear pricing, inconsistent availability, limited comparison and manual payment coordination.
Small operators have limited digital presence, while disputed vehicle-damage claims create a need for stronger verification and inspection records.
The product.
A centralized multi-vendor marketplace brings local inventory, availability, bookings and digital payments into one workflow. Vendor tools support listings, calendars, pricing and booking management.

Business model.
Booking commission is the primary model. Potential revenue streams include approximately 10–20% commission, vendor subscriptions, promoted listings and future vendor-growth services.
Who it serves.
Goa tourists and local users, including families, couples, solo travellers, repeat visitors, hotel guests and long-stay travellers arranging transport before arrival.
